Preparing search index...
The search index is not available
Additional types and utils for TypeScript
type-plus
IsNotStringLiteral
_U
Type Alias _U<T, U, $O>
_U
<
T
,
U
,
$O
>
:
U
extends
`
${
any
}
`
?
$ResolveBranch
<
T
,
$O
,
[
$Else
]
>
:
U
extends
Uppercase
<
infer
N
>
?
IsNotStringLiteral
.
_D
<
N
,
$O
>
:
U
extends
Lowercase
<
infer
N
>
?
IsNotStringLiteral
.
_D
<
N
,
$O
>
:
$ResolveBranch
<
T
,
$O
,
[
$Then
]
>
Type Parameters
T
U
$O
extends
$SelectionOptions
Settings
Member Visibility
Protected
Inherited
External
Theme
OS
Light
Dark
type-plus - v8.0.0-beta.6
Loading...